如题所述
c语言编写计算字符串长度的程序是一个经典的面试问题,有几种经典的答案:
1,循环
定义一个指针 char * p = str;
int count = 0;
while (*p != \0){
p++; count++;
}
2, 递归
3,最简短的,利用地址的差
while(*p++);
len = p - str;